Wooden Veranda Construction in Fairfield County, CT

Wooden veranda construction involves creating outdoor living spaces that extend from the main structure of a property, offering a charming and functional area for relaxation, entertaining, or enjoying the outdoors. These projects typically include building new verandas or upgrading existing ones, with options for custom designs, railings, flooring, and support structures. Homeowners often request this service to enhance curb appeal, increase outdoor living space, or add character to their homes, making it important to consider factors such as the style of the property, desired size, and material choices before requesting a project.

Property owners usually want to understand the scope of work involved, including the materials used, the design options available, and the overall durability of the finished veranda. It’s helpful to consider the compatibility with existing architectural features, any necessary permits, and how the new structure will function with the property’s layout and landscaping. Clear communication about expectations and preferences can ensure the project aligns with the homeowner’s vision for a beautiful and practical outdoor addition.

FAQ

Wooden Veranda Construction Questions

What types of wood are used for verandas? Common options include cedar, redwood, and pressure-treated pine, chosen for durability and appearance.

Can a wooden veranda be added to an existing deck? Yes, it can be integrated with existing structures or built as a standalone addition.

What design styles are available for wooden verandas? Designs range from traditional to modern, with options for custom railings, posts, and flooring patterns.

Is it possible to customize the size of a wooden veranda? Yes, verandas can be tailored to fit specific space requirements and property layouts.
